The Canon Snappy 20 of September 1982 was a 35mm compact camera for budget-conscious photographers, and was an early member of the Canon Snappy series of cameras. It was available in several colours, namely black, red, yellow, white, and blue.

Specifications

  • Lens: 35mm, f/4.5 (4 elements in 4 groups).
  • fixed focus.
  • Auto-exposure, 1/20-1/500s.
  • Integrated flash. (GN: 11m at ISO 100)
  • Power: 2 AA alkaline batteries.
